In this time span, most locations will experience two high tides, when the location is close to and far from the moon, and two low tides. Despite having diverse times and amplitudes – which are strongly affected by aspects like the shape of coastlines or the nearshore bathymetry of a given place – all tidal cycles follow the same stages: the sea level rises over the course of a few hours (flood tide), reaches its highest point (high tide), falls over several hours (ebb tide), and hits its lowest level (low tide). This causes the waters to bulge from the surface of the Earth, and the sea level of that particular nearshore area to rise. The rise of water level is called high tide and its fall is called low tide. In a semi-diurnal cycle, both the high waters and the low waters of each day usually differentiate in height, consequently creating the concepts of higher high water and lower high water for high tides, and higher low water and lower low water in low tides. However, there are different types of tides throughout the planet. They happen in periods of around 6 hours between each other and represent both the highest and lowest level of water of a specific location along the coastline. This transition between high tide and low tide takes around 6 hours, making it so that there are [usually] two high tides and two low tides in every lunar day (24 hours and 50 minutes), before the moon returns to the same location in the sky. In any given location along the coastline, high tides occur when the moon is directly above – and thus closest to – that very region, its gravitational force pulling all bodies towards its core. They are manifested by vertical movements of the sea surface (the height maximum and minimum are called high water [HW] and low water [LW]) and alternating horizontal movements of the water, the tidal currents.
